First-day checklist item 4 — contractor access, Orrin Fabrication Works. Report to the gatehouse on the Thornfield site by 08:00 and collect your high-vis vest and induction pack. Your supervisor will walk you through the workshop layout and sign your permit-to-work for the week. Note: contractor passes are not activated until the induction quiz is complete, usually by midday. Until then, the turnstile at Gate C will not read your badge, so enter using the temporary code below.

turnstile pass: bdg-XQD-3

// Notes for the weekly eng sync re: Gallerywhisper, our museum audio-guide app.
// This constant sets the prefetch radius for exhibit audio clips. At the
// Hollen Pavilion pilot we learned visitors walk faster than our original
// estimate, so clips were buffering mid-stride. Bumping this to three rooms
// ahead fixed it, at a modest bandwidth cost. Don't lower it without testing
// on the slow gallery wifi first — seriously, it's painful. The trace token
// from the pilot build that validated this number is appended just below.

trace token, kahap-bagaf: htk4_8458

Subject: DeployPing bot access for your integration

Hi Fernvale integrations team,

Thanks for agreeing to pilot the DeployPing chat bot. It posts deploy status updates into your channels whenever a rollout starts, pauses, or completes, and it answers status queries in plain language. Your plugin should subscribe to the webhook feed and respond within five seconds to avoid retries. Rate limits are generous but enforced per workspace. To connect your sandbox workspace, configure the bot with the bearer token included below.

session JWT of yawep-yawep = eyJhbGciOiJIUzI1NiIsInR5cCI6IkpXVCJ9.eyJzdWIiOiI3pWF3_In0.aXYsHiog